Like all core sets, M20 does not have one single setting, even though they may have associated story vignettes that are set in a specific time and place. For example, while there were stories published for M19 that were set on ancient Dominaria and Tarkir, that does mean that all the cards in the set were actually associated with those settings.

Pretty much every edition (core set) from Alpha up to about...oh, 7th edition, were set on Dominaria. I want to say 8th-10th were but I cannot be sure. I know some of the M sets focused on Shandalar and Origins was a cluster**** of different places due to the emphasis on the 'walkers pre- and post-spark activation.
Edit: Ok, I lied. Sets like 4th Edition and 5th had cards from Legends, which some supposedly took place on Shandalar (Osai Vultures) and Segovia (Segovian Leviathan), for example. That doesn't included sets like Revised and onward with reprints from Arabian Nights which we know took place on Rabiah. So whoever above said it did say that no edition has a single plane where they take place. I'm not even sure that Alpha through Unlimited took place on Dominaria as a whole either.

I can't find anything that supports Dominaria properly existed prior to Antiquities. They certainly fit most if not all locations mentioned in Alpha and Beta into Dominira by creating a kind of "yah it's there somewhere" space called the Domains. Of course, none of this considers how you define the plane of the cards with real-world flavor text.
I can't find anything that supports Dominaria properly existed prior to Antiquities.
I belive Dominaria wasn't a thing even during Antiquities. Antiquities cards referred only to Dominia (the Multiverse); it was erratad to Dominaria much later.
